Etna: Winter excursion to 3.000mt

Summary Description

Experience a once-in-a-lifetime adventure and take in breathtaking views on this guided hike to Europe's highest active volcano.

Accompanied by an expert Volcanological Guide, immerse yourself in the typical winter landscapes and admire Mount Etna in all its beauty.

The excursion begins at our info Point Ashàra located at the Sapienza Etna Sud Refuge.

After a short briefing and having provided all the necessary equipment, our adventure will begin.

With the cable car we will climb up to an altitude of 2500m, and from here and we will begin our trekking, between ancient and recent lava flows, up to an altitude of 3000m, admiring the peculiarity of the summit air.

Highlights of the tour include: The ancient crater of the Montagnola, Piano del Lago, Cisternazza, Craters of 2002 and the summit area.

Descent again on foot up to 2500m (cable car terminal) which will take us back to the starting point.

At the discretion of the guide and for safety reasons, given the continuous and unpredictable evolution of volcanic activity, the excursions could undergo variations and, above all, could be modified according to weather conditions and volcanic activity.
